Kep & Debbie May 2023 Update

We are thankful for your prayers during the past few months we’ve been teaching in Africa. In April, I led three 4-day training retreats in Zambia and Burundi. In our study of Romans we saw the Lord encourage many African church pastors and leaders. Many expressed that they had never studied the Bible, and even admitted that their churches have gotten off track from the gospel.

In Kasempa and Ndola, Zambia, 80 church leaders decided to study Romans in their local churches. In Bujumbura, Burundi, another 70 committed to this. One pastor from neighboring Congo decided to start doing this in his church, and another in Botswana informed us that as a result of last year’s ESI training in Tanzania, he is already taking 50 members of his church through Romans.

This week, we are in Nairobi visiting 8 ESI groups that began in Kenya in February. We always try to visit groups when they start to make sure they are on track with the plan to keep Jesus and the gospel in their center of their Bible study and group discussion.

One of the most encouraging developments in our ESI work in East Africa is to have Paulo and Vania join our ESI team. They are missionaries from Brazil whom God called to be missionaries in Burundi. They are giving significant time inviting pastors to join ESI, planning and giving oversight to the trainings, then following up once the groups begin. Having them with us in the ESI leadership team is making it possible to effectively begin this work in East Africa.

On May 30, we will join Paulo and Vania in Sao Paulo and Rio de Janeiro, Brazil to train 120 pastors and Church Leaders in the study of Romans. Please pray that the Lord will allow us to help strengthen the church in Brazil, to see it get back on track with Jesus and the Gospel at the center.
